excel中怎么控件

excel中怎么控件

在Excel中使用控件的步骤主要包括:启用开发者工具、插入控件、配置控件属性、编写VBA代码。 其中,启用开发者工具是使用控件的前提,插入控件是操作的核心步骤,而配置控件属性和编写VBA代码则是实现特定功能的关键。接下来,我们将详细介绍这些步骤,帮助你在Excel中有效地使用控件。

一、启用开发者工具

要在Excel中使用控件,首先需要启用开发者工具。开发者工具提供了插入各种控件的功能选项,以及VBA编程环境。

1. 启用开发者选项卡

  1. 打开Excel,点击左上角的“文件”选项卡。
  2. 选择“选项”,打开Excel选项对话框。
  3. 在Excel选项对话框中,选择“自定义功能区”。
  4. 在右侧的主选项卡列表中,勾选“开发工具”。
  5. 点击“确定”按钮,返回Excel主界面,此时你会看到开发工具选项卡出现在功能区中。

启用开发者工具后,你就可以使用各种控件来增强你的Excel表格。

二、插入控件

Excel提供了多种控件,如按钮、复选框、组合框等,每种控件都有其特定的用途和配置方法。

1. 插入按钮控件

  1. 切换到开发者工具选项卡。
  2. 点击“插入”按钮,在下拉菜单中选择“按钮(窗体控件)”。
  3. 在工作表中点击或拖动鼠标,绘制一个按钮。

2. 插入复选框控件

  1. 在开发者工具选项卡中,点击“插入”。
  2. 选择“复选框(窗体控件)”。
  3. 在工作表中点击或拖动鼠标,绘制一个复选框。

3. 插入组合框控件

  1. 在开发者工具选项卡中,点击“插入”。
  2. 选择“组合框(窗体控件)”。
  3. 在工作表中点击或拖动鼠标,绘制一个组合框。

三、配置控件属性

不同的控件有不同的属性,配置这些属性可以帮助你实现特定的功能和交互。

1. 配置按钮控件属性

  1. 右键点击按钮,选择“指派宏”。
  2. 在弹出的对话框中选择或新建一个宏,点击“确定”。

2. 配置复选框控件属性

  1. 右键点击复选框,选择“格式控件”。
  2. 在“控制”选项卡中,设置“单元格链接”。
  3. 点击“确定”完成设置。

3. 配置组合框控件属性

  1. 右键点击组合框,选择“格式控件”。
  2. 在“控制”选项卡中,设置“输入范围”和“单元格链接”。
  3. 点击“确定”完成设置。

四、编写VBA代码

VBA(Visual Basic for Applications)是Excel中的编程语言,通过编写VBA代码,你可以实现更复杂和灵活的功能。

1. 打开VBA编辑器

  1. 在开发者工具选项卡中,点击“Visual Basic”按钮。
  2. 在VBA编辑器中,选择你要编写代码的工作表或模块。

2. 编写简单的VBA代码

下面是一个简单的示例代码,它展示了如何在按钮点击时显示一个消息框:

Sub Button1_Click()

MsgBox "Hello, World!"

End Sub

将以上代码粘贴到VBA编辑器中,然后保存。

3. 运行VBA代码

返回Excel工作表,点击按钮,你会看到一个消息框弹出,显示“Hello, World!”。

五、控件的实际应用

在实际应用中,控件可以用于各种场景,如数据输入、动态更新、表格交互等。

1. 数据输入

通过使用控件如文本框和下拉列表,你可以简化数据输入过程,提高数据的准确性。例如,可以使用组合框列出可选项,让用户选择而不是手动输入。

2. 动态更新

通过使用按钮和复选框,你可以创建动态更新的表格。例如,可以使用按钮触发数据刷新,或者使用复选框控制显示或隐藏某些数据。

3. 表格交互

控件可以增强表格的交互性,使其更具吸引力和实用性。例如,可以使用滑块控件调整数据范围,或者使用旋钮控件改变图表的显示。

六、进阶技巧

对于高级用户,可以结合使用控件和复杂的VBA代码,实现更高效和智能的Excel表格。

1. 动态生成控件

你可以通过VBA代码动态生成和配置控件。例如,下面的代码展示了如何在运行时生成一个按钮:

Sub CreateButton()

Dim btn As OLEObject

Set btn = ActiveSheet.OLEObjects.Add(ClassType:="Forms.CommandButton.1", _

Link:=False, DisplayAsIcon:=False, Left:=100, Top:=100, Width:=100, Height:=30)

btn.Object.Caption = "Click Me"

btn.Name = "DynamicButton"

End Sub

运行这段代码后,你会在工作表中看到一个新的按钮,点击该按钮可以触发相应的事件。

2. 复杂事件处理

通过编写复杂的事件处理代码,你可以实现更高级的功能。例如,可以使用复选框控制不同的数据集显示,或者使用按钮触发复杂的数据分析过程。

七、常见问题和解决方案

在使用控件的过程中,可能会遇到一些常见问题,下面是一些解决方案。

1. 控件显示异常

如果控件显示异常,可能是由于工作表缩放比例或显示设置导致的。尝试调整工作表缩放比例,或者检查显示设置。

2. VBA代码出错

如果VBA代码出错,检查代码语法和逻辑,确保没有拼写错误或逻辑错误。使用断点和调试工具可以帮助你定位和解决问题。

3. 控件属性配置失败

如果控件属性配置失败,检查控件类型和属性设置,确保配置正确。某些属性可能仅适用于特定类型的控件。

八、总结

在Excel中使用控件可以大大增强表格的功能和交互性。通过启用开发者工具、插入控件、配置控件属性和编写VBA代码,你可以实现各种复杂和灵活的功能。掌握这些技巧不仅可以提高你的工作效率,还可以使你的Excel表格更加专业和智能。

希望这篇文章能帮助你在Excel中更好地使用控件。如果你有任何问题或需要进一步的帮助,请随时联系我。

相关问答FAQs:

1. 在Excel中如何添加控件?

在Excel中添加控件非常简单。首先,打开Excel并进入开发者选项卡。然后,点击“插入”按钮,在下拉菜单中选择“控件”。在弹出的对话框中,您可以选择不同类型的控件,如按钮、复选框、下拉列表等。选择您需要的控件后,将其拖动到您想要放置的位置即可。

2. 如何设置控件的属性和样式?

要设置控件的属性和样式,首先选中您想要修改的控件。然后,右键单击该控件并选择“属性”选项。在属性窗口中,您可以更改控件的名称、字体、颜色、大小等。此外,您还可以设置控件的行为,如点击事件、悬停提示等。通过调整这些属性和样式,您可以定制控件以满足您的需求。

3. 如何在Excel中使用控件进行数据输入和操作?

使用控件进行数据输入和操作非常方便。例如,您可以使用文本框控件来接收用户输入的数据。只需在Excel中插入一个文本框控件,然后用户就可以在该文本框中输入数据。同样,您还可以使用按钮控件来触发特定的操作,如运行宏或执行计算。通过在Excel中使用控件,您可以轻松地收集和处理数据,提高工作效率。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4335433

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部